About The Position

About UofL Health: UofL Health is a fully integrated regional academic health system with five hospitals, four medical centers, nearly 200 physician practice locations, more than 700 providers, the Frazier Rehabilitation Institute and Brown Cancer Center. With more than 12,000 team members—physicians, surgeons, nurses, pharmacists and other highly skilled health care professionals—UofL Health is focused on one mission: delivering patient-centered care to each and every patient each and every day. Job Description: Position Summary and Purpose The President, Acute Hospitals serves as the top executive leader for all in-patient hospitals within the healthcare system and is responsible for setting strategic direction, ensuring operational excellence, and fostering a culture of patient-centered care, innovation, and financial sustainability. This role is accountable for the overall performance of the hospitals, including clinical quality, financial health, employee engagement and community impact.

Responsibilities

  • Together with UofL Health, develops the regional acute hospitals strategic plan and is responsible for its execution.
  • Engages, actively develops, and supports effective governance, relationships, communication and succession planning.
  • Monitors the regions hospitals quality assurance and compliance plans, assuring compliance with federal, state, and local regulations. Observes patient quality metrics and identifies opportunities to enhance the quality of patient care services. Actively participates and supports quality, patient experience and performance improvement programs and is accountable for the performance and outcomes of these programs.
  • Serves as the regional ambassador at community events and outreach programs. Develops and maintains relationships with referral sources, healthcare providers, and community organizations to drive growth, innovation and problem solving.
  • Champions impactful internal communication strategies and recognition programs, ensuring consistent messaging and employee engagement.
  • Refers, coordinates, and collaborates with UofL Health leadership on patient and employee safety, risk, contract and legal matters.
  • Collaborates with UofL Health leadership to establish growth goals and is mutually accountable in achieving growth goals.
  • Participates in the development of budgets for all programs/services. Supports UofL Health and drives regional performance to meet/exceed budgeted performance. Maintains accountability for financial performance.
